Two days after jumping into River Jhelum at Cement Kadal in Noorbagh area, body of teenage girl was retrieved on Friday morning, officials said here.

Official sources told the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O) that body of 15-year-old girl was retrieved by sand extractors and river Police Srinagar at Palpora area of Noorbagh after hectic efforts.

They identified the deceased as Ulfat Bashir daughter of late Bashir Ahmad of Bagwanpora Noorbagh.

Meanwhile, an official said that body will be handed over to family after completing legal formalities—(KNO)
